City profile is a document that captures all relevant information from authenticated sources for example census, national family health survey, city NUHM PIP and others required to understand city’s socioeconomic status, health indicators of the city, resources available in the city to make an informed city proposal. The city profile will be used to have a glance of critical indicators and taking timely decision. The profile will be updated annually to keep the TCIHC team updated.
